Junk removal vs dumpster services in Bartlesville - Which is right for you?
When you own a job you are going to undertake at home, you may be wondering if it's better to hire someone to come haul off all your trash and crap for you, or in the event you need to only rent a dumpster in Bartlesville and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better alternative in the event you would like the flexibility to load it on your own time and you also do not mind doing it yourself to save on labour. Dumpsters also work nicely in the event that you've at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Rolloffs normally begin at 10 cubic yards, so if you just have 3-4 yards of waste, you are paying for much more dumpster than you desire.
Trash or rubbish removal makes more sense if you would like another person to load your old stuff. In addition, it functions nicely if you would like it to be taken away immediately so it's out of your hair, or in the event that you only have a few big things; this is probably cheaper than renting an entire dumpster.
Long-Term vs Roll off dumpsters
Whether or not you need a permanent or roll off dumpster depends upon the type of job and service you'll need. Long-Lasting dumpster service is for ongoing demands that continue more than just a day or two. This includes things like day-to-day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is just what the name implies; a one-time need for job-special waste removal.
Temporary roll off d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they'll be properly used. These are generally larger containers that can manage all the waste that comes with that specific job. Long-Lasting dumpsters are generally smaller containers because they are emptied on a regular basis and so do not need to hold as much at one time.
If you request a long-term dumpster, some firms demand at least a one-year service agreement for this dumpster. Roll off dumpsters merely require a rental fee for the time that you just keep the dumpster on the job.

What's the smallest size dumpster accessible?
The smallest size roll off dumpster commonly accessible is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is roughly equal to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a good choice for small projects, including small dwelling cleanouts.
Other examples of projects that a 10 yard container would work nicely for contain: A garage, shed or loft c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or soil removal Getting rid of waste Be constantly aware that weight constraints for the containers are imposed, thus exceeding the weight limit will incur additional fees. The standard we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in will help you take good care of small projects round the house. For those who have a bigger project coming up, take a peek at some bigger containers also.
Dumpster Rental in Bartlesville Costs: Flat Rate vs Per Ton
If you are seeking to rent a dumpster in Bartlesville, one of your main considerations is going to be price. There are generally two pricing options available when renting a dumpster in Bartlesville. Flat rate is pricing dependent on the size of the dumpster, not the amount of stuff you put in it. Per ton pricing will charge you based on the weight you need hauled.
One type of pricing structure is not necessarily more expensive than the other. Knowing just how much stuff you need to throw away, you might get a better deal with per short ton pricing. On the other hand, flat rate pricing is able to help you keep a limitation on costs when you are coping with unknown weights. Whether you regularly rent dumpsters for work or just require a one-time rental for a project around the house, you want to search around to find the best rental costs based on your needs.

What Size Dumpster Do I Want for a Roofing Job?
Picking a dumpster size demands some educated guesswork. It's often difficult for individuals to gauge the sizes that they need for roofing jobs because, realistically, they have no idea how much stuff their roofs feature.
There are, however, some basic guidelines you can follow to make the ideal alternative. If you're removing a commercial roof, then you'll likely need a dumpster that provides you at least 40 square yards.
If you're working on residential roofing project, then you can usually rely on a smaller size. You can typically exp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will likely want a 20-yard dumpster.
A lot of people order one size bigger than they believe their jobs will take because they want to stay away from the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ters that weren't large enough.
What's the Dissimilarity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have features which make them useful for various kinds of jobs.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job place and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They usually have open tops as well as a door on the front. That makes it simple for workers to load a wide selection of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the earth. The arms tip to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This really is a useful option for businesses that collect considerable am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are usually left on place,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set program. That makes it possible for sterilization professionals to eliminate garbage and rubbish for multiple dwellings and businesses in the region at affordable prices.

Determining Where to Put Your Dumpster
Determining where to put your dumpster can get a large impact on how quickly you complete endeavors. The most efficient alternative would be to select a location that's near the worksite. It is vital, however, to consider whether this location is a safe alternative. Make sure that the place is free of obstacles that could trip folks while they take heavy debris.
A lot of folks choose to put dumpsters in their own drives. It is a handy alternative as it generally means you can avoid requesting the city for a license or permit. In the event you need to put the dumpster on the street, then you definitely should get in touch with your local government to inquire whether you need to get a permit. Although many municipalities will let people keep dumpsters on the road for brief amounts of time, others will ask you to fill out some paperwork. Following these rules can help you avoid fines that can make your job more expensive.
10 yard dumpster measurements in Bartlesville
A 10 yard dumpster is constructed to carry 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ure about 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although exact container sizes will vary with different firms.
It may be hard to select just the container size you will need for your house endeavor,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ller clean-up occupations. To give you an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would carry:
- Debris cleanout from a basement or garage A 250 square foot deck that's been removed
- A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
- The debris from a little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job
If your job is big enough that you do not have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but little enough that you do not need an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should function flawlessly.
